Firefighters cut drivers free from cars after serious collision

TWO drivers have been involved in a serious head-on collision near Angmering.

Emergency services were called to Roundstone by-pass on the A280 after the cars collided with each other at around 3pm.

The road has been closed between the A259 roundabout and Water Lane.

One man involved in the collision was released and treated by paramedics before firefighters arrived.

A further man and woman were trapped in separate cars, with firefighters using hydraulic equipment to cut them free from the vehicles.

The man was taken to hospital by ambulance, while the woman was checked at the roadside by paramedics.

There were two fire engines from Littlehampton and one heavy rescue tender from Worthing at the scene.
